January: Wolf – The Lone Seeker

Traits: Loyaltyindependenceperseverance
The wolf symbolizes resilience and leadershipmaking it a perfect spirit animal for January-born individuals who aregoal-oriented and fiercely independent. Wolves also reflect the duality of solitude and communityencouraging balance. A wolf tattoo can be an artistic nod to personal strength and the importance of finding your pack.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• Lone wolf howling at the moon
  • A tribal-style wolf symbol
  • Two wolves symbolizing internal duality

February: Owl – The Wise Soul

Traits: Wisdomintuitionmystery
Owls represent deep insight and heightened intuition, aligning perfectly with the soulful and thoughtful nature of those born in February. This spirit animal guides people to trust their inner wisdom and see beyond illusions.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• Owl with a moon or clock motif
  • Geometric owl designs to emphasize intellect
  • Owl wings spread wide in flight

March: Dolphin – The Joyful Explorer

Traits: Playfulnessempathyadaptability
Dolphins are playful yet highly intelligent creatures, reflecting the March-born’s blend of creativity and emotionaldepth. This spirit animal encourages living with joy and embracing life’s currents with grace.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• A dolphin diving through waves
  • Watercolor-style dolphin with ocean elements
  • Dolphins intertwined with stars or constellations

April: Falcon – The Bold Visionary

Traits: AmbitionFocusCourage
Each Bird Tattoo has its own symbolism and Vibe,The Falcon embodies Determination and the drive to pursue goals, just like those born in April. With sharp Focus and Bravery, falcons Soar high above Challenges, urging individuals to keep their eyes on the prize.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• A falcon in mid-flight or perched, ready to hunt
  • Abstract falcon designs with wings spread
  • Falcon with Sun rays behind it, symbolizing ambition

May: Bear – The Protective Spirit

Traits: StrengthStabilityNurturing
Bears symbolize PowerCourage, and Protection, ideal for May-born individuals who are both Fierce and Nurturing. This spirit animal also represents Introspection and the Wisdom of knowing when to rest and recharge.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• A roaring bear in black ink
  • Mother bear with cubs, symbolizing family
  • Bear amidst trees or a mountain landscape

June: Butterfly – The Symbol of Transformation

Traits: Growthchangelightness
June marks a time of transition, and the butterfly tattoo is the perfect symbol for those born in this month. The butterfly’s journey from caterpillar to flighted beauty reflects personal growth, renewal, and embracing life’s transformations.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• Butterfly wings morphing into flowers
  • Minimalist line art butterfly on the wrist or collarbone
  • A swarm of butterflies in vibrant colors

July: Lion – The Regal Protector

Traits: Courageleadershiployalty
The lion, often associated with strength and royalty, perfectly suits the bold and protective nature of July-born individuals. This majestic animal embodies couragepride, and a deep sense of loyalty toward loved ones.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• A roaring lion with a crown or mane in flames
  • Lion tattoo with roses, symbolizing both strength and beauty
  • Abstract lion face split into geometric patterns

August: Dragonfly – The Free Spirit

Traits: Freedomadaptabilityspiritual connection
Those born in August thrive on exploration and embrace change with grace, much like the dragonfly. This spirit animal also carries spiritual symbolism, urging people to reflect and remain flexible.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• Dragonfly hovering over water
  • Dragonfly with mandala wings
  • Delicate watercolor dragonfly on the shoulder or ankle

September: Fox – The Clever Strategist

Traits: Clevernessadaptabilitywit
The fox symbolizes agility and strategic thinking, making it a fitting spirit animal for sharp-minded September-born individuals. This animal embodies the ability to adapt and find clever solutions to life’s challenges.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• A curled-up fox with intricate patterns
  • Fox with autumn leaves to signify change and renewal
  • Playful fox in mid-leap, capturing its lively nature

December: Stag – The Noble Guardian

Traits: Gracewisdomleadership
The stag embodies both gentleness and powersymbolizing leadership rooted in compassion. December-born individuals are often wise and grounded, yet their spirit calls for adventure and freedom.

Tattoo Ideas:

  • Winter-themed stag with snowflakes and stars
  • A stag within a triangle cosmic or celestial background
  • Stag head with antlers entwined with flowers or vines
